Why Movement Quality Matters in Sport
Every sport places specific demands on the body. Running requires hip stability and ankle mobility. Lifting demands spinal control and joint alignment. Field and court sports rely on rotation, agility, and coordinated power.
If joints aren’t moving as well as they should, other areas of the body often compensate. Over time, this can lead to reduced performance, tightness, recurring niggles, or more significant injuries.
Chiropractic care focuses on assessing how your spine and other joints are functioning. By identifying restrictions or imbalances, we can help restore normal movement and improve overall biomechanics.

Key Ways Chiropractic Care Supports Athletic Performance
Improving Joint Mobility and Range of Motion
Optimal performance requires efficient, controlled movement. Chiropractic adjustments aim to restore proper joint motion, particularly within the spine and pelvis. Improved mobility can enhance power output, running mechanics, lifting technique, and overall coordination.
Supporting Nervous System Function
Your nervous system controls muscle activation, balance, and reaction time. When spinal movement is restricted, it can affect how the nervous system communicates with the body. By improving spinal mechanics, chiropractic care helps support clearer communication between the brain and muscles, which may contribute to better control and performance.
Reducing Injury Risk
Small imbalances often build gradually before becoming injuries. Regular appointments can identify early warning signs such as asymmetry, reduced mobility, or joint stiffness. Addressing these proactively can reduce strain on surrounding muscles and tissues, helping to lower the risk of common sports injuries.
Enhancing Recovery
Training creates stress on the body. Recovery allows adaptation and progress. Chiropractic care can help reduce mechanical tension, improve circulation through better movement, and support the body’s natural recovery processes - making it easier to stay consistent with training.
